Released in 2001 as part of the Southern Islands set, the Ledyba trading card (card number 7) is a Basic Grass-type Pokémon with 40 HP. Designed by Keiko Fukuyama, this Reverse Holo variant offers a distinctive finish that appeals to collectors focusing on specific set treatments. The card features two attacks: Colorless Gnaw, dealing 10 damage, and Grass Agility, which deals 20 damage and includes a unique effect—flipping a coin to potentially prevent all attack effects on Ledyba during the opponent's next turn if heads is flipped. With a retreat cost of 1, this card represents a strategic option in the early Pokémon TCG landscape. Card Text
Abilities, attacks, oracle text, and flavor text printed on the card.
Attack: Gnaw (10)
Attack: Agility (20)
Flip a coin. If heads, during your opponent's next turn, prevent all effects of attacks, including damage, done to Ledyba.
When it senses enemies approaching, this Pokémon releases an orange fluid from the joints in its legs and flees.
